4H2-40000 Hydrogen Electrochemical Sensor 
(P/N: SEC-4H2-40000)

 
 
Technical Specifications
MEASUREMENT 
Operating Principle 3-electrode electrochemical
Detection Range 0~40000 ppm
Maximum Overload 200 ppm
Sensitivity 1.5 ± 0.7 nA/ppm
Response Time (T90) 120 s  
Repeatability <±2% signal
Linearity Linear
Long term output Drift <2% signal/month

ELECTRICAL
Resolution 200 ppm
Recommended Load 5~35 
Bias Voltage 0 mV

ENVIRONMENTAL
Operating Temp. Range -20°C ~ 50°C
Operating Humidity Range 15% RH ~ 90% RH non-condensing
Operating Pressure Range 800 ~ 1200 mbar

LIFETIME
Recommended Storage Temp. 0°C to +20°C in sealed container
Expected Operating Life 24 months in air
Storage Life 6 months in original packaging
Standard Warranty 12 months

Whilst the Gas Sensor are designed to be highly specific to the gas they are intended to measure, they will still respond to some degree to various gases. The table below is not exclusive and other gases not included in the table may still cause a sensor to react. The cross-sensitivity values quoted are based on tests conducted on a small number of sensors. They are intended to indicate sensor response to gases other than the target gas. Sensors may behave differently with changes in ambient conditions and any batch may show significant variation from the values quoted.
SAFETY NOTE:
Connection should be made via a PCB mounting socket. Soldering to pins will void the sensor's warranty.
It is important that exposure to high concentrations of solvent vapours is avoided, both during storage, fitting into instruments, and operation;
If the Gas Sensor is removed from application circuit, a jumper should be added on 'R' and 'S' pin.
As applications of use are outside our control, the information provided is given without legal responsibility. Customers should test under their own conditions, to ensure that the sensors are suitable for their own. The data is given for guidance only.
